这个需要每个手机运行一个,然后连接服务器,手机端是客户端,会检测客户端发送的消息,然后服务器端发送消息后,客户端会将消息转发到微信朋友圈。
ui界面:
脚本代码:
=====================================================
Dim 布局名称,点击坐标,话术,分割话术,随机值,文本,id,结果,时间,端口,返回的数据
布局名称 = "xkrj5.com 开源版1"
'创建一个名称为布局名称的布局控件
TracePrint UI.Newlayout (布局名称)
'添加一个名称为"输入框1",初始内容为"请在此输入内容"的文本框控件
TracePrint UI.AddEditText(布局名称, "输入框2", "192.168.1.8")
TracePrint UI.AddEditText(布局名称, "输入框3", "12345")
'显示名称为:布局名称 的布局控件
TracePrint UI.NewRow(布局名称, "new_row")
'创建一个名称为"按钮1",标题为:"点我初始化"的按钮控件
'创建一个名称为"按钮1",标题为:"全自动打招呼"的按钮控件
TracePrint UI.AddButton(布局名称, "按钮2", "点我连接服务器")
TracePrint UI.NewRow(布局名称, "new_row")
'TracePrint UI.AddRadioGroup(布局名称,"选择功能",{"普通私信", "截屏私信", "粉丝私信"},0)
'设置名称为"按钮1"的控件的控件点击事件
TracePrint UI.SetOnClick("按钮2", 点我私信)
TracePrint UI.Show (布局名称)
Function 点我私信()
id=UI.GetText("输入框2")
TracePrint UI.Close(布局名称)
End Function
'创建一个初始化处理函数
Function 点我初始化()
End Function
For i = 1 To 99999999999999999999999
Import "shanhai.lua"//
Import "socket.lua"
socket.CliendConnect id, "12345"
Call socket.ClientSend("监听命令...")
Call socket.ClientSend("SendMessage")
返回的数据 = socket.ClientReceive()
Dim MyString
MyString = Split(返回的数据,"---")
Call shanhai.GetHttpFile(MyString(1),"/sdcard/Pictures/WeiXin/wx_camera_1643116684789.jpg")
Delay 3000
ShowMessage "正在执行..."
'创建一个初始化处理函数
TracePrint 返回的数据
Tap 672,99
Delay 1000
Tap 357, 1117
Delay 1500
ShowMessage "正在选择图片"
Tap 142, 166
Delay 200
Tap 563, 90
Delay 2000
ShowMessage "准备输入内容"
Tap 163, 180
Delay 200
InputText MyString(0)
ShowMessage "已输入朋友圈内容"
Delay 3000
Tap 626, 91
Delay 3000
ShowMessage "已发送一条朋友圈广告"
'创建一个初始化处理函数
ShowMessage "等待命令"
Next
====================================================
标签:控件,TracePrint,微信,布局,Delay,按键精灵,UI,朋友圈,名称 From: https://www.cnblogs.com/javakji/p/17842176.html